NTSB Narrative Summary Released at Completion of Accident

THE PILOT STATED THAT HE HELD THE AIRCRAFT IN A CRABBED ATTITUDE THROUGHOUT THE TOUCHDOWN PHASE OF LANDING TO COMPENSATE FOR A CROSSWIND CONDITION. ON TOUCHDOWN THE NOSE AND MAIN LANDING GEAR COLLAPSED AND THE AIRCRAFT SLID ON ITS BELLY FOR APPROXIMATELY 330 FEET AND CAME TO A STOP.
